Thermoguard Thermocoat S is a high-performance, solvent-based intumescent paint system providing robust fire resistance to structural steel and cast iron. This advanced intumescent coating is engineered to protect load-bearing steel for up to 90 minutes, safeguarding the structural integrity of buildings during a fire. When the intense heat of a fire triggers a catalytic reaction, Thermocoat S swells to create a dense, insulating char layer up to 50 times the paint thickness. This char layer effectively keeps the steel below its critical temperature, preventing collapse and allowing more time for safe evacuation.

Applications
- Coverage: Prior to application the contractor should contact us and obtain a basecoat application schedule or follow on can guidance. Do not overspread as this will compromise the system and result in non-compliance and a failure to be certified
- Primer: Steel must be primed with a good quality anti-corrosive primer compatible with intumescent paints. We recommend one good coat of Thermoguard Steel Fire Paint Primer to 75 microns DFT. Alternatively, a zinc phosphate or other primer confirmed as compatible can be used.
- Basecoat: Apply Thermocoat S in accordance with the project-specific Thermoguard film thickness schedule. To receive this schedule, contact our technical department. The minimum number of coats will be specified to achieve the required fire rating.
